After “hanging” opponent, Casemiro receives punishment in the English Championship

Already Manchester United win this Saturday, the Brazilian Casemiro took the red card after “hanging” Will Hughes, player of Crystal Palace. With that, the defensive midfielder will receive the punishment of three games and will miss the Red Devils in upcoming Premier League matches.

The aggression occurred at 25 minutes of the second half, after an estrangement between the Brazilian Antony and Schlupp, from Crystal Palace, turned into a widespread confusion. Casemiro put his hands around opposing midfielder Will Hughes’s neck.

Referee Andre Marriner had not seen the move on the field and reviewed the aggression in VAR. After the consultation, the English referee presented the red card straight to Casemiro. In English football, the standard punishment for direct sending-offs is the three-game hook.

In this way, the Brazilian defensive midfielder will lose the Manchester United against Leicester City and the two duels against Leeds United, in the Premier League. The probable return of Casemiro should be in the confrontation with Barcelonafor the knockout round of the Europa League.

Coach Erick Ten Hag will have to think about how he will climb the Red Devils in the next appointments, considering the absence of Casemiro and Eriksen (injury) in midfield. Asked about the expulsion of the Brazilian, the coach admitted that Casemiro “crossed the line”, but charged a punishment to the Crystal Palace players.

“It’s a very difficult move because I see two teams fighting. I see two teams of players crossing the line and one player is selected and sent off. For me that is not right,” declared the Manchester United coach.
